1stKOSBWarDiary

The usual amount of shelling and mortaring during the day.


Little activity was seen of the enemy during daylight, but at dusk several enemy were seen walking about, one of them half dressed in civilian clothes.


Between 1815 hrs and 1830 hrs the enemy were heard driving stakes into the ground in area 799324, and there were sounds of men marching, and vehicles moving in an Easterly direction at about 800321.


Areas 803325, 802323 and 803320 were engaged by 33 Fd Regt at 1845 hrs.


A and D standing patrols were out during the day, but saw and heard very little movement.


D Coy recce patrol reported three of the enemy coming out of the house in the North-East corner of the orchard at 789317.


At 2135 hrs a platoon of C Coy under Sgt Robertson reported shooting up an enemy patrol of six or seven men coming out of the wood at 796324, probably wounding one of them.


D Coy patrol reported two of the enemy in orchard at 798317.
